**Action item (P2):** The Glintworks checkout widget regression slipped through because half our snapshot tests were stale and auto-approved. On-call: re-baseline the snapshots for the CartPanel and PromoBanner components, and turn off bulk-approve in the pipeline. Takes maybe an hour. Steps and the approval checklist live on the internal page below.

operations page: https://jenkins.xolmarsys.corp/repo

Q: How does the cleaning crew get in after hours?

The Dellhaven crew arrives weekdays after 19:00. Verify the supervisor's name against the roster sheet at the desk. Crew members do not hold permanent badges. Sign the supervisor in, issue a yellow contractor lanyard, and log the headcount. They must exit by 22:30. Admit them through the service door using the contractor code below.

door code, bahop-fawep: bdg-VTAUT-0

- [ ] **Step 7: Breaker override escrow.** After sealing the signing keys for the Tallgrove upstream API circuit breaker, confirm the support team can force the breaker open during a full outage. The override bundle lives in the sealed escrow drawer and is useless without its unlock phrase. Two ceremony witnesses must initial this step before proceeding. The escrow bundle is decrypted with the recovery passphrase that follows.

vault phrase of kahip-kahop = holath-quenmir

Deploy step for the Moonwake tide-table widget: verify the tidal dataset version matches the coastal region config, then build the widget bundle and run the rendering checks for all supported harbors. Do not promote until the staging preview matches the reference charts exactly. Before uploading to the distribution channel, sign the bundle using the following key:

rollout seal: bky4_x7Gc